pottery open workshop
These non-instructional sessions allow you to use our studio to practice on the wheel or finish work started in class. Both fall and winter sessions use high-fire stoneware clay. Only work produced at the Shadbolt Centre from clay purchased here can be fired in our kilns. Open workshops are offered on a drop-in, first-come basis. These sessions are not designed to accommodate “production” potters but to allow students to develop their skills.

deer lake park heritage walking tour
Deer Lake Park is Burnaby's best-preserved heritage area and features a fascinating collection of Edwardian country homes and landscapes. The homes surrounding Deer Lake, built between 1904 and 1935, were developed by their owners with an idealized view of the English countryside in mind. "Splendid mansions surrounded by spacious lawns and grounds soon tell the visitor that this district is one of the choice country residential sections for the wealthy of Vancouver and New Westminster," reported one newspaper in 1912. The landscapes designed for many of these gracious old homes remain integral to the experience of the lakeshore setting and convey a special sense of history to the park visitor. Burnaby's Community Heritage Commission has developed a 1 1/2- 2-hour self-guided walking tour, which highlights the history of these protected heritage buildings. Pick up a free guide at Burnaby Village Museum, Shadbolt Centre for the Arts or Burnaby Art Gallery.
